Practical Metal Polishing - Frequently, the finishing of metal is needed for aesthetic reasons or for clean-room applications. It's one of the more recognized techniques for its success in bettering the overall attractiveness of the item, such as, cookware, auto parts or motorbike parts. Equally, a large number of clean-rooms will want a sleek finish to limit the penetrability of the metal surfaces which can result in debris to gather and contaminate. An instance of this use could be in a vacuum chamber.

There exist plenty of different ways to polish metal, and let's have a peek at several of the techniques required. Metals may be burnished electromechanically, chemically, by hand, or with specialized buffing machines. A buffing compound or paste is frequently utilized, which may consist of dolomite, limestone, tripoli, aluminum oxide, chromium oxide, chalk, or iron oxide.

Polishing stainless steel, because of its substandard thermal conductivity, its hardness, and its relatively high viscidness is generally one of the most time-consuming. Opposite of that scenario, products produced with non-ferrous metal are much more receptive to finishing, because they demand the lowest number of procedures.

A reduced pad speed can be used any time a top quality mirror finish is called for. Polishing buffs smeared with paste will be markedly affected by specific pressures on the surface of the finishing pad. The strength of the pressure on the surface could be accelerated within certain constraints, having said that, further exceeding the maximum degree of load not simply lowers the quality of the process, but additionally worsens efficiency, could cause wear to the part, and in addition a conspicuous heating of the metal being worked on, being a result of friction. When working thinner items, it will be greater temperature (and a subsequent flexibility of the material) that causes items to distort, warp or buckle. In most cases, it will take a trained polisher to factor in all these fundamentals to both not cause damage to the piece and to work successfully. To radically boost the standard of the resultant surface, the finishing procedure will have to be implemented with not as much aggression and not so much force to be able to consequently produce a surface that is free of scratches or fine lines due to the the finishing procedure, thereby ending up with a fantastic mirror finish.
